Q2 Planning Note — Heads of Department

Gross margins held up better than we feared — 41.2% overall, with the Kestrel line doing the heavy lifting. Packaging costs at the Dunmow plant are still eating into the Orlo range, so procurement is renegotiating with Varrick Supply next month. Keep discretionary spend tight until then. The broader plan this feeds into is set out in the note below.

management briefing: Jorixax Holdings is in early talks to buy Casixax Holdings for about $420.3 million. The Fenmir launch date is October 27, and nothing goes to the press before then. Legal wants the Keloxek Foods term sheet redrafted before April 16.

Priority this quarter: second-source supplier for the resin housings currently sole-sourced from Tarrowgate Molding. Procurement has shortlisted three candidates; qualification samples due in six weeks. Engineering to run validation in parallel, not sequentially. Budget impact capped at 120K for tooling duplication. Do not alter current Tarrowgate order volumes — relations stay normal until qualification completes. Status updates biweekly at the ops sync. The confidential reasoning driving this search is noted below.

board note of tawip-hahip: Only 7 of the 80 pilot accounts renewed Ralath, so a churn review is set for April 1.

Meeting notes — 14:00, Pooling sync (Project Cabrelle)

- Pool exhaustion on the Ostwind cluster traced to leaked handles in the reporting service.
- Max pool size stays at 40; do not raise it without review.
- Contractor task: add idle-timeout metrics to the Larkspool dashboard by Friday.
- Staging credentials rotate Thursday; expect brief connection churn.
- Questions on pool config or the migration plan should go to the engineer named below.

named custodian: Brivan Eliath Quenox Frador